dts: rk3399-puma: add DTS for RK3399-Q7 (Puma) SoM
The RK3399-Q7 is a system-on-module featuring the Rockchip RK3399 in a Qseven-compatible form-factor. These changes add a device-tree describing the board and its interfaces for basic functionality (e.g. GbE, SPI, eMMC, SD-card). This includes the following changes from the original development: * dts: rk3399-puma: include DTS for RK3399-Q7 SoM in the Makefile * dts: rk3399-puma: add gmac for the RK3399-Q7 This change enables the Gigabit Ethernet support on the RK3399-Q7. * dts: rk3399-puma: use serial0 for stdout * dts: rk3399-puma: prepare the sdmmc node for SPL booting * dts: rk3399-puma: enable spi1 and spi5, add /spi1/spiflash The RK3399-Q7 (Puma) unsually (this is a build-time option for customised boards) has an on-module SPI-flash connected to SPI1. As of today, this is a Winbond W25Q32DW (32MBit) device. The SPI5 controller is routed to the Q7 edge connector and provides general-purpose SPI connectivity for customer base-boards.
